BODY {
	scrollbar-3dlight-color: #DA7310;
	scrollbar-darkshadow-color: #000000;
	scrollbar-track-color: #ffffff;
	scrollbar-arrow-color: #ffffff;	
	scrollbar-face-color: #DA7310;
	scrollbar-shadow-color: #ffffff;
	scrollbar-highlight-color: #ffffff;	
}
	
A {	
	color: #000000; }

A:hover{
	color: #8B2C00; }

table {
   background-color:#d5e6b5;
   font-family:verdana;
   font-size:11px;
}

.Auteur {
	color: black;
	font-weight: bold;
	font-size: 10pt;
	font-family: verdana;
}

.SECTIONS{
	color: #DA7310;
}

.SEARCH{
	color: #8B2C00;
}

.BUTTON{
	border:outset #DA7310 2px;
	background-color:#DA7310;
	color:#ffffff;
	font-size:12px;
}

.FIND{
	color: #0000ff;
}

h1 {
	margin-bottom:0em;
	font-family: verdana;
	font-size: 13px;
	color:#DA7310;
}

h2 {
	margin-bottom:0em;
	font-family: verdana;
	font-size: 20px;
	color:#DA7310;
	font-weight: normal;
}

h3 {
	margin-bottom:0em;
	font-family: verdana;
	font-size: 13px;
	color:#000000;
}

h4 {
	margin-bottom:0em;
	font-family: verdana;
	font-size: 16px;
	font-weight: normal;
}
h5 {
	margin-bottom:0em;
	font-family: verdana;
	font-size: 13px;
	color:#000000;
	font-weight: normal;
}

.CONTENT {
	margin-top:0em;
}

.highlight {
    background : #FFFF00;
    font-weight: bold;
}

.nouveaute {
    margin-bottom:10px;
}

	/********Nouveaute**********/
	/***************************/
	/*module position nouveaute*/
	div.nouveaute div.boxtop {
		width:153px;
		height:10px;
		font-size:0px;
		line-height:0px;
		background-image: url(images/nouveautes/orangetop.jpg);
		background-position:top left;
		background-repeat:no-repeat;
	}
	div.nouveaute div.moduletable { /*moduletable is default container class*/
		width:153px;
		background-image: url(images/nouveautes/orangeback.jpg);
		background-position:top left;
		background-repeat:repeat-y;
	}
	div.nouveaute div.boxbottom {
		width:153px;
		height:18px;
		font-size:0px;
		line-height:0px;
		background-image: url(images/nouveautes/orangebottom.jpg);
		background-position:top left;
		background-repeat:no-repeat;
	}
	div.nouveaute div.moduletable h3 { /*module title in "-2" mode*/
		width:150px;
		font-size:15px;
		height:22px;
		font-weight:normal;
		margin:0;
		padding:0;
		text-align:center;
		color:white;
	}
	div.nouveaute div.moduletable table {
		width:110px;
		margin-left:14px;
		color:white;
	}

	div.nouveaute td.contentheading {
		color:#4B6400;
	}


#font6  {font-size:6pt;  font-family:Verdana, Arial, Helvetica; line-height:150%;}
#font7  {font-size:7pt;  font-family:Verdana, Arial, Helvetica; line-height:150%;}
#font8  {font-size:8pt;  font-family:Arial, Helvetica; line-height:170%;}
#font9  {font-size:9pt;  font-family:Arial, Helvetica; line-height:170%;}
#font10 {font-size:10pt; font-family:Arial, Helvetica; line-height:170%;}
#font11 {font-size:11pt; font-family:arial; line-height:170%;}
#font12 {font-size:12pt; font-family:arial; line-height:170%;}
#font13 {font-size:13pt; font-family:arial; line-height:170%;}
#font14 {font-size:14pt; font-family:arial; line-height:170%;}
#font15 {font-size:15pt; font-family:arial; line-height:170%;}
#font16 {font-size:16pt; font-family:arial; line-height:170%;}
#font18 {font-size:18pt; font-family:arial; line-height:160%;}
#font20 {font-size:20pt; font-family:arial; line-height:160%;}
#font24 {font-size:24pt; font-family:arial; line-height:170%;}

#dfont7   {font-size:7pt;   font-family:Verdana; line-height:150%;}
#dfont8   {font-size:8pt;   font-family:Verdana; line-height:170%;}
#dfont9   {font-size:9pt;   font-family:Verdana; line-height:170%;}
#dfont10  {font-size:10pt;  font-family:Verdana; line-height:170%;}
#dfont11  {font-size:11pt;  font-family:Verdana; line-height:170%;}
#dfont12  {font-size:12pt;  font-family:Verdana; line-height:170%;}

#font6px  {font-size:6px;  font-family:新細明體; line-height:170%;}
#font7px  {font-size:7px;  font-family:新細明體; line-height:170%;}
#font8px  {font-size:8px;  font-family:新細明體; line-height:170%;}
#font9px  {font-size:9px;  font-family:新細明體; line-height:170%;}
#font10px {font-size:10px; font-family:新細明體; line-height:160%;}
#font11px {font-size:11px; font-family:arial; line-height:160%;}
#font12px {font-size:12px; font-family:arial; line-height:170%;}

linkWG  {font-family:arial;}
 A.linkWG:link    {	COLOR: #F4F4F4; TEXT-DECORATION: none	}
 A.linkWG:visited {	COLOR: #F4F4F4; TEXT-DECORATION: none	}
 A.linkWG:active  {	COLOR: ORANGE; TEXT-DECORATION: none	}
 A.linkWG:hover   {	COLOR: ORANGE; TEXT-DECORATION: underline  }

linkGrayR  {font-family:arial;}
 A.linkGrayR:link    {	COLOR: #5F7D1E; TEXT-DECORATION: none	}
 A.linkGrayR:visited {	COLOR: #5F7D1E; TEXT-DECORATION: none	}
 A.linkGrayR:active  {	COLOR: #AC6413; TEXT-DECORATION: underline	}
 A.linkGrayR:hover   {	COLOR: #AC6413; TEXT-DECORATION: underline  }

.cachediv {
		visibility: hidden;
		overflow: hidden;
		height: 1px;
		margin-top: -1px;
		position: absolute;
	}


/*******************************************************************/
 /* FAQ SECTION */
 /***************/
 
 /* Body Styles */
/*body {margin: 0; background: #ffffff}
p,td,li,pre {font: normal 10px verdana,arial,helvetica,sans-serif; color: #808080}
ul {list-style: square}
h1 {font: bold 17pt arial,helvetica,tahoma,sans-serif; color: steelblue}
h2 {font: bold 13px verdana,arial,helvetica,sans-serif; color: steelblue}
h3 {font: bold 12px verdana,arial,helvetica,sans-serif; color: #808080}

a {color: steelblue}
a:hover {color: #255B86}*/
pre {
 margin-bottom: 0;
 white-space: -moz-pre-wrap;  /* Mozilla, supported since 1999 */
 white-space: -pre-wrap;      /* Opera 4 - 6 */
 white-space: -o-pre-wrap;    /* Opera 7 */
 white-space: pre-wrap;       /* CSS3 - Text module (Candidate Recommendation)
                                 http://www.w3.org/TR/css3-text/#white-space */
 word-wrap: break-word;       /* IE 5.5+ */
}


.hrz_line 		{background: #a1a1a1}
.hrz_line2 		{background-image: url(images/hrz_line.gif); height: 1px}
.colorbar 		{background: #76A8DB}
.colorbar2 		{background: #255B86}
.foot 			{background: #F4F4F4; padding-right: 2em}
.poptop, .popbot {background: #F4F4F4}
.popbot 		{padding-top: 3px; padding-bottom: 3px; padding-left: 1em}
.nav_special 	{color: #ADCEEF; margin-right: 2em}
.nav_link 		{color: #ffffff; text-decoration: none}
.category 		{font-size: 10pt; margin-bottom: 0.5em}

dt 			{font: bold 10pt verdana,arial; padding-top: 1em}
dd 			{font: normal 8pt verdana,arial; line-height: 18px}
.QA 		{font: normal 18pt arial, helvetica,tahoma; color: #cccccc; width: 10px}
.question 	{font-weight: bold; margin: 0; padding: 1px; font-size: 10pt}
.answer 	{font-weight: normal; color:#666666; margin: 0; padding: 3px; font-size: 10pt}

/* Table Styles */
.tablehead 	{background: #dddddd}
.rowA 		{background: #EBECED}
.rowB 		{background: #ffffff}
.rowC 		{background: #E5E5E5}

/* Form Styles */
.textfield 		{font-family: verdana, sans-serif; font-size:11px; color:#666666; background:#ffffff; border-top:1px solid #bbbbbb; border-left:1px solid #bbbbbb; border-bottom:1px solid #dddddd; border-right:1px solid #dddddd;}
.submit 		{font: normal 8pt "verdana","arial mt","arial narrow","arial"; background: #639BC5; color: #ffffff; border: #cccccc 1px outset}
select 			{font: normal 7pt "verdana","arial mt","arial narrow","arial"; color: #616161;}
select.nav_sel 	{font: normal 7pt "verdana","arial mt","arial narrow","arial"; color: #30678F; background: #ADCEEF}
form 			{margin: 0}

/* END FAQ SECTION */
/*******************************************************************/


/*******************************************************************/	
/* MENU SECTION */

#nav, #nav ul {	
	list-style: none;
	background: #8BB43E;	
	border: solid #d5e6b5;
	border-width: 0px 0;
	overflow:auto;	}

#nav a {
	display: block;
	width: auto;
	color: white;
	text-decoration: none;	}

#nav li {
	float: right;
	width: auto;
	border-style: solid ;
	border-width: 0px 1px 0px 0px ;
	border-color: #993300;
	padding : 0 0.5em 0 0.5em	}

#nav li ul {
	position: absolute;
	left: -999em;
	height: auto;
	width: 22em;	
	border-width: 0.25em;
	margin: 0;
	overflow:auto;}
	
#nav li:hover ul {
	left: auto;	}	
	
#nav li:hover ul, #nav li.sfhover ul {
	left: auto;	}		
	
/* END MENU SECTION */
/*******************************************************************/	

/*
	Couleur des pubs vert   : 139/180/62 (#8bb43e)
	Couleur des pubs orange : 218/115/16 (#DA7310)
	Couleur de fond vert p滎e : 213/230/181 (#d5e6b5)
*/

